    Explained: Why Cameron Green’s IPL 2026 bidding war won’t cross INR 18 crore in the auction?

    As the IPL 2026 mini-auction approaches, Australian all-rounder Cameron Green is one of the most coveted players, with several teams like KKR and CSK reportedly preparing to engage in a bidding war for the 26-year-old. With his explosive batting and handy bowling skills, Green’s price could exceed Rs. 18 Crore.

    Why Cameron Green will command a high price at IPL 2026 Auction

    Cameron Green is widely expected to be one of the most sought-after players in the IPL 2026 mini-auction, scheduled for December 16, 2025, in Abu Dhabi. Teams like Kolkata Knight Riders (KKR) and Chennai Super Kings (CSK), both of which have large purses, are expected to lead the charge for Green’s signature. His all-around ability makes him a valuable asset in T20 cricket, especially with KKR needing a replacement for Andre Russell and CSK looking to add more firepower in their foreign player contingent.

    In the previous mini-auction, foreign players like Mitchell Starc and Pat Cummins fetched record amounts. Green’s performance in the 2023 auction, where he was bought by Mumbai Indians (MI) for Rs. 17.5 Crore, further adds to his market value, and many predict that his price could easily cross the Rs. 20 Crore mark. However, there’s a catch: no matter the bidding war, Green’s final price cannot exceed Rs. 18 Crore, thanks to a new IPL policy.

    Reasons why Cameron Green’s IPL 2026 auction price is unlikely to cross Rs. 18 crore

    However, due to a new IPL rule introduced last year, Green cannot be sold for more than Rs. 18 Crore, no matter how high the bids go. The rule in question was introduced by the IPL to ensure fairness in the auction process and to address concerns about overseas players registering only for mini-auctions to secure inflated bids. According to the rule, the maximum salary for any overseas player in a mini-auction is capped at the highest retention price or auction price for an Indian player from the previous mega-auction.

    In IPL 2025, the highest retention amount for an Indian player was Rs. 18 Crore. As a result, no foreign player in the mini-auction, including Green, can be paid more than this amount, regardless of the final bid. This rule aims to curb the tendency of overseas players opting out of mega-auctions for the higher payouts typically seen in mini-auctions. If Green’s bid exceeds Rs. 18 Crore, the excess amount will not go to him. Instead, it will be diverted to the BCCI for player welfare. This ensures that while Green can still fetch a high price, his earnings remain capped at Rs. 18 Crore.

    IPL 2026 Auction: How the cap affects teams and Green’s earnings

    While this cap limits Green’s direct earnings, it also impacts the bidding strategy of franchises. If a team bids more than Rs. 18 Crore, they will still have to bear the entire cost, but the amount beyond Rs. 18 Crore will be deducted from their auction purse, with the extra funds allocated to player welfare.

    This new rule, introduced to ensure a more level playing field in the mini-auction, has certainly stirred the auction dynamics. Teams can still aggressively pursue high-profile overseas players like Green, but their spending will be limited by the cap, ensuring that the funds are used more equitably across all franchises.

    Despite the rule that caps his earnings at Rs. 18 Crore, Green’s IPL 2026 auction is still likely to be one of the most talked-about events of the season. Given the demand for foreign all-rounders and the competitive nature of IPL mini-auctions, his final price will likely hover near the upper limit. However, even if bidding crosses the Rs. 18 Crore mark, Green will only pocket that capped amount, with the excess going to the BCCI for the benefit of the players’ welfare. This ensures a unique dynamic in the upcoming IPL auction that balances team finances with the well-being of players.
